1. Bird’s Eye View: Understanding Parking Options

1.1 Overview of Parking Facilities at YKF

Waterloo Regional Airport offers a well-organized parking layout that makes it easy for travelers to choose the best spot for their needs. Here’s a rundown of the different parking types available to help you make the right decision:
  • Short-Term Parking (P3)
    • Purpose: Perfect for quick pick-ups & drop-offs.
    • Price: $3/hour, max $24/day, with the first 60 minutes FREE.
    • New rates starting October 1, 2024: $4/hour, max $28/day.
    • Access: More Details
  • Premium Parking (P4)
    • Purpose: Situated right next to the terminal for utmost convenience.
    • Price: $16/day, with the first 60 minutes FREE.
    • New rates starting October 1, 2024: $20/day.
    • Access: More Details
  • Value Parking Lot
    • Purpose: Budget-friendly option for longer stays.
    • Price: $11/day, with a new rate of $15/day post-Oct 1, 2024.
    • Access: More Details

4. Parking Payment: How to Pay & What to Expect

4.1 Payment Methods

When it comes to paying for parking at YKF, you’ve got options! Accepted payment methods include VISA, Mastercard, American Express, debit, & even cash! Just keep in mind that cash can only be paid at pay stations, NOT at the gate exits, so plan accordingly!

4.2 Tips for Smooth Exiting

Navigating your way out just got easier! There’s a 20-minute grace period for payment, giving you a little leeway. If you lose your ticket, don’t worry; just approach someone at the Information Desk, & they’ll guide you through the process. 7. The Electric Avenue: Parking for Electric Vehicles

7.1 EV Charging Stations

Have an electric vehicle? Good news! There are two EV charging stations located near the main terminal. With charging capacity for four vehicles, you won't be left high & dry. For more tips on finding EV charging spots, go to learn more about EV Charging.

The parking experience at Waterloo Regional Airport has gone HIGH-TECH! They use a TIBA-based Automated Parking System which makes it a breeze. Here's how you can use it:

  • When you arrive, you’ll push a SILVER BUTTON and a ticket will be dispensed along with your details like the vehicle license plate, date & time of entry embedded with a digital barcode.
  • When it's time to leave, simply head for either the East exit lane (credit/debit cards ONLY) or the West exit lane (cash, credit, or debit accepted). The system will automatically recognize your vehicle's license plate and calculate your fees based on how long you've parked.
